The FREOX is the dimension where everytrhing is closer to solid than in the Overworld. Note that a pickaxe can harvest ice when in the FREOX. Any lakes and oceans are made of liquid nitrogen, as it is too cold to have liquid water. Lava instantly solidifies into cobblestone. Blazes artificially spawned here take 1.5 hearts of damage every second, due to heat contrast. Endermen rarely spawn, usually once per chunk per 15000 seconds. FREOX mobs are immune to liquid nitro damage, just like nether mobs are immune to lava damage.

Portal[]
The portal to the FREOX is constructed like a lunar or photic portal, just with redstone oxide blocks in the corners, an iodine block in the middle, and blue stained glass for the rest of the frame. It requires a hit of 250000 J in less than half of a second to open.

FREOX Castle[]
A freox castle is a large structure, usually hundreds of blocks wide and hundreds long. It contains monsters like Inflourates and cryomancers. The freox castle is usually between 150 and 200 block tall. The chests of a freox castle contain a lot of iridium nuggets and a few iridium ingots for any oddball reason. The freox castle is mostly made of things like blue ice and some walls made of cerium. In every castle, there are just enough resources to forge 2 portals back to the Overworld.
